Italy: Tutto Bio 2011 now available

by Redaktion (comments: 0)

The yearbook of Achille Mingozzi and Rosa Maria Bertino, Tutto Bio 2011, is available now. It costs 16 euros and can be purchased in various stores in Italy or online here. 8,500 organic operators in Italy are published on 336 pages. The new Bio Bank report is also featured, which compares the numbers of organic operators of 2010 to those of 2008.

According to the Bio Bank report, direct sales in Italy recorded the most important growth. There are 740 purchasing groups now in the country, a growth of 55 % in the past three years, and more than 2,400 farms and farm shops are offering organics, the number of  which rose by 25 % in the same period of time. The highest density of organic operators was found in Trentino-Alto Adige, followed by Marche and Valle d'Aosta. Regarding the absolute numbers of operators, Emilia-Romagna, Lombardy and Tuscany were the most important regions. The increase of organic operators split in eight groups, based on absolute numbers in the last three years (2008 / 2010), was as follows: purchasing groups + 55 %, e-commerce + 38 %, direct sales + 25 %, restaurants + 24 %, agri-tourism + 11 %, school canteens 10 %, farmers' markets 7 %, and shops +4 %.

This year's theme of Tutto Bio is "Organic, Ecological, Ethics: when green ideas become jobs", with sixteen stories dedicated to those who have transformed ideas into a real business in sectors like organic agriculture, catering, cosmetics and ecological fashion, sustainable architecture and renewable energies, or recycling. Bio Bank is the database of the organic, sustainable and ethical trade in Italy. Work began in 1993 and was updated year after year through direct surveys of thousands of operators. A database shows the evolution of the sector, keeps track of the changes, and reveals statistics.
